Navigators of Dune


The third volume in the landmark Schools of Dune trilogy - the inspiration for the HBO Original series DUNE: PROPHECY!A New York Times bestseller, Brian Herbert and Kevin J. Anderson's Navigators of Dune is the climactic finale of the Great Schools of Dune trilogy, set 10,000 years before Frank Herbert's classic Dune.The story line tells the origins of the Bene Gesserit Sisterhood and its breeding program, the human-computer Mentats, and the Navigators (the Spacing Guild), as well as a crucial battle for the future of the human race, in which reason faces off against fanaticism. These events have far-reaching consequences that will set the stage for Dune, millennia later.

Sci-fi žáner poznáme aj pod pojmom vedecko-fantastická literatúra, poprípade science fiction. V týchto dielach sa dostaneme do budúcnosti, pričom dej sa opiera o súčasnú vedu, techniku a o predpoklady jej ďalšieho vývoja. Medzi hlavné témy sci-fi patrí pokročilá veda a technológia, prieskum vesmíru, cestovanie v čase, paralelné vesmíry a mimozemský život. Sci-fi má pravdepodobne svoje korene v antickej mytológii. Súvisí s fantasy, hororom a fikciou o superhrdinoch. Sci-fi v literatúre, filme, televízii a iných médiách sa stala populárnou a vplyvnou vo veľkej časti sveta. Nazýva sa tiež „literatúra myšlienok“ a často skúma potenciálne dôsledky vedeckých, sociálnych a technologických inovácií.

Medzi najznámejších autorov sci-fi žánru patrí Isaac Asimov, Octavia E. Butler, Arthur C. Clarke, William Gibson, Herbert Frank, Robert A. Heinlein, Ray Bradbury, Margaret Atwoodová a Karel Čapek.

Fantasy literatúra sa zaoberá fiktívnymi svetmi, bytosťami a udalosťami Tento žáner obsahuje prvky nadprirodzena, mágie, mýtov, legend a imaginárnych bytostí, ako sú napríklad draci, víly, čarodejníci, orkovia a ďalší.

Fantasy literatúra vytvára bohaté a detailné fiktívne svety, ktoré sa líšia od realistického prostredia. Príbehy z tohto žánru sa často zameriavajú na hrdinské cesty, dobrodružstvá, boje medzi dobrom a zlom, epické konflikty a príbehy o nadprirodzených schopnostiach a magických predmetoch. Fantasy literatúra má dlhú a bohatú históriu, pričom mnohé jej klasické diela vznikli už v 19. a 20. storočí. 

K najznámejším autorom fantasy pattrí J. R. R. Tolkien, autor kultového fantasy Pán prsteňov. Určite poznáte tiež J.K. Rowlingovú, ktorá vytvorila zázračný svet Harryho Pottera.ďalšími známymi autormi sú napríklad George R.R. Martin a jeho Pieseň ľadu a ohňa známejšia pod názvom sfilmovaného seriálu Hry o tróny, C.S. Lewis, ktorá napísal Kroniky Narnie, Terry Pratchett, Ursula K. Le Guin, či Robert Jordan.
